Biografia:

Carbon Leaf é uma banda de indie rock de Richmond, Virginia, conhecidos pela sua mistura Country, Folk Celta e infusão de Indie Rock.

Os membros da banda:

Barry Privett: Vocais, guitarra acústica, gaita de foles e outros;
Terry Clark: Guitarra elétrica , violão , vocal;
Carter Gravatt: Acústico elétrico bandolim , violão, guitarra elétrica, violino, rabeca e outros;
Jason Neal: Bateria, percussão;
Jon Markel: Baixo elétrico, baixo acústico.
